Miami Dolphins running back Jaylen Wright is a healthy scratch for the second straight week on Sunday against the visiting Los Angeles Chargers at Hard Rock Stadium. Wright got off on the wrong foot in 2025 due to an injury and just hasn't been able to establish himself in Miami's backfield behind starter De'Von Achane. Although rookie Ollie Gordon II hasn't had much of a role behind Achane through five weeks, he has been the preferred chance-of-pace option over Wright, even though Wright is now healthy. The 22-year-old Wright has not played in a game yet in 2025 after carrying the ball 68 times for 249 yards in 15 games (one start) in his rookie campaign in 2024. He also caught three passes for eight yards. Fantasy managers can continue to leave Wright on the waiver wire in redraft leagues.

New York Giants running back Cam Skattebo's incredible emergence makes him a must-start, albeit risky, low-end RB1/high-end RB2 for the tough road matchup in Denver. Skattebo, currently the 10th-ranked fantasy RB averaging 15.22 points per game, is coming off a massive 28 fantasy point performance where he rushed for 98 yards and three touchdowns against the Eagles. This week, his volume will be tested against the Broncos' elite defense, which ranks 4th against fantasy running backs, allowing only 17.47 fantasy points per game. Crucially, the Denver defense has been a red-zone wall, ranking 1st in the NFL by allowing a minuscule 28.6% touchdown rate and a league-low two rushing touchdowns all season, directly threatening Skattebo's primary source of his five touchdowns. Skattebo's immense workload and role near the goal line, however, keep his ceiling high despite the difficult on-paper matchup against a run defense allowing just 89 rushing yards per game.
